云服务器网:购买云服务器和VPS必上的网站!

如何利用H5快速连接MSSQL数据库

随着HTML5的流行,愈来愈多的人使用HTML5实现项目的Web前端开发。使用HTML5的优点是它可以支持大多数现代浏览器,而不需要安装 plugin,而且实现起来也比之前更加快捷,可以极大地提高开发效力。但HTML5在处理数据库时有一个重要的问题:它不能直接

随着HTML5的流行,愈来愈多的人使用HTML5实现项目的Web前端开发。使用HTML5的优点是它可以支持大多数现代浏览器,而不需要安装 plugin,而且实现起来也比之前更加快捷,可以极大地提高开发效力。但HTML5在处理数据库时有一个重要的问题:它不能直接连接数据库,而一定要通过服务器来实现。

不过,如果希望使用HTML5快速连接MSSQL数据库,可以通过Node.js来实现。Node.js是一个基于 JavaScript 语言的服务器端开发框架,可以通过Node.js框架来连接MSSQL数据库,将数据以JSON格式返回到前端。

首先,安装Node.js,具体方法可参考Node.js官网,地址是:https://nodejs.org/en/。

接下来,安装经常使用的Node.js连接MSSQL数据库的模块——mssql模块,方法是:

npm install mssql

安装成功后,就能够连接数据库了,连接MSSQL数据库的基本代码示例以下:

const sql = require('mssql/msnodesqlv8')
const config = {
//数据库信息
}

sql.connect(config).then(()=>{
//连接成功触发,然后可以进行数据库操作
}).catch((err)=>{
//连接失败触发
})

上面的代码示例中,config是数据库信息,具体参数有:

driver:MSSQL Driver,可以指定区别的版本,可使用 “msnodesqlv8” 或 “tedious”

server:数据库服务器的地址

database:要连接的数据库的名称

user:数据库的登陆名

password:数据库的登陆密码

完成数据库配置信息和代码配置后,便可运行代码来连接MSSQL数据库,将数据以JSON格式返回前端,实现前后真个快速交互。

以上就是利用HTML5快速连接MSSQL数据库的方法,通过使用Node.js和mssql模块来实现。虽然连接数据库相对来讲有一定复杂度,但是熟习后,可以节省很多时间,实现快速数据交互。

本文来源:https://www.yuntue.com/post/94275.html | 云服务器网,转载请注明出处!

关于作者: yuntue

云服务器(www.yuntue.com)是一家专门做阿里云服务器代金券、腾讯云服务器优惠券的网站,这里你可以找到阿里云服务器腾讯云服务器等国内主流云服务器优惠价格,以及海外云服务器、vps主机等优惠信息,我们会为你提供性价比最高的云服务器和域名、数据库、CDN、免费邮箱等企业常用互联网资源。

为您推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注